#ed1dc8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ed1dc8 is composed of 92.9% red, 11.4%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 15.6%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 310.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 52.2%. #ed1dc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3aff with #db0091.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#ed1dc8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ed1dc8 has RGB values of R:237, G:29,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.16,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15539656.

Hex triplet ed1dc8 #ed1dc8
RGB Decimal 237, 29, 200 rgb(237,29,200)
RGB Percent 92.9, 11.4, 78.4 rgb(92.9%,11.4%,78.4%)
CMYK 0, 88, 16, 7
HSL 310.7°, 85.2, 52.2 hsl(310.7,85.2%,52.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 310.7°, 87.8, 92.9
Web Safe ff33cc #ff33cc
CIE-LAB 55.131, 85.364, -38.246
XYZ 45.79, 23.057, 56.679
xyY 0.365, 0.184, 23.057
CIE-LCH 55.131, 93.54, 335.866
CIE-LUV 55.131, 91.916, -70.872
Hunter-Lab 48.018, 86.185, -36.372
Binary 11101101, 00011101, 11001000

Shades and Tints of #ed1dc8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0109 is the darkest color, while #fef7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ed1dc8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868485 is the less saturated color, while #f614ce is the most saturated one.
